// Code generated by software.amazon.smithy.rust.codegen.smithy-rs. DO NOT EDIT.
/// <p>Contains information about whether the stack's actual configuration differs, or has <i>drifted</i>, from its expected configuration, as defined in the stack template and any values specified as template parameters. A stack is considered to have drifted if one or more of its resources have drifted.</p>
#[non_exhaustive]
#[derive(::std::clone::Clone, ::std::cmp::PartialEq, ::std::fmt::Debug)]
pub struct StackDriftInformation {
/// <p>Status of the stack's actual configuration compared to its expected template configuration.</p>
/// <ul>
/// <li>
/// <p><code>DRIFTED</code>: The stack differs from its expected template configuration. A stack is considered to have drifted if one or more of its resources have drifted.</p></li>
/// <li>
/// <p><code>NOT_CHECKED</code>: CloudFormation hasn't checked if the stack differs from its expected template configuration.</p></li>
/// <li>
/// <p><code>IN_SYNC</code>: The stack's actual configuration matches its expected template configuration.</p></li>
/// <li>
/// <p><code>UNKNOWN</code>: This value is reserved for future use.</p></li>
/// </ul>
pub stack_drift_status: ::std::option::Option<crate::types::StackDriftStatus>,
/// <p>Most recent time when a drift detection operation was initiated on the stack, or any of its individual resources that support drift detection.</p>
pub last_check_timestamp: ::std::option::Option<::aws_smithy_types::DateTime>,
}
